Transaction 53a8171e2d86cd7ddfa1453ad569d62bb2cf476534f950bce5efb7f44e016623

11 Input
2 Outputs
  • 53a8171e2d86cd7ddfa1453ad569d62bb2cf476534f950bce5efb7f44e016623:0
  • value  30000000
    address  37mE974MH6hA6AUR5TD3eeqWXp5qszF3e8
  • 53a8171e2d86cd7ddfa1453ad569d62bb2cf476534f950bce5efb7f44e016623:1
  • value  3252846
    address  3NhwVvdehXJhw8Ubi6TmmYX4F1f1CqaN2H